TAMA TW-07 "twangtonized"

This TAMA TW07 Dreadnought has a special history. It was born as a typical dreadnought in Japan in the 70s, then came to Germany and ended up with us in the 2000s. We built in the high-quality Shadow Dual System with piezo and magnetic pickups that can be adjusted in balance. She was also repainted in a very special finish.
And then its real story began: We wanted to send it around the world with musicians who are a lot on the road. And we wanted her to tell stories that the musicians experienced with her. After all, she had been on the road in the USA, Germany and France for three to four years, and there was a website and a blog about this TAMA TW07, which we called RED GUITAR TRAVELING. Anyway: Now she has been back home for some time and is supposed to take the next step. Because she doesn't want to retire.

The TW07 is a typical dreadnought with a solid spruce top and a mahogany body. It has the Shadow Dual System, which sounds very good, and comes in an ultra-stable Hiscox case. It plays great, it was played a lot (what you see) and is a reliable partner in all situations.
